SUMMARY
Responsible for providing academic instruction to children in a year-round partial hospitalization school setting. The Teacher may be called upon to provide therapeutic interventions at any time.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
Implements all academic components within the classroom to include following the specified curriculum and benchmarks as set forth by St. Vincent Family Center.
Communicates with parents, on an as needed basis, regarding student/client academic concerns.
Tracks absences and tardiness of students/client.
Completes and disseminates grade cards four (4) times per year.
Conducts a minimum of two (2) Parent-Teacher conferences during the school year.
Makes recommendations to the psychologist regarding further student/client testing (i.e. if the child needs an IEP).
Collect data and documentation then communicates as an active member of the treatment team.
Attend development classes as requested by supervisors.
Assists the Adaptive Behavioral Specialist with mental health interventions, as needed.
Implements and uses trauma informed care services.
Implements Collaborative Problem-Solving strategies.
Is sensitive to the cultural and socioeconomic characteristics of the children and families served.
Performs general office duties to include, filing, copying, faxing and customer service.
Other duties as assigned or requested.
E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E
Bachelor's degree in education or related field is required. Masters in Special Education is preferred.
Current licensure to teach preferred.
Physical Demands
While performing the duties of this job, the employee is regularly required to sit, stand, walk, talk and listen.
The employee is occasionally required to climb or balance, stoop, kneel, crouch, or crawl.
The employee may occasionally lift and/or move up to 15 pounds.
Ability to complete crisis intervention training and successfully pass course for certification and perform techniques to a satisfactory level.
Work Environment
The noise level in the work environment is usually moderate.
May experience loud, verbal displays of outbursts from potentially distressed children seeking treatment.
While performing the duties of this job, the employee is exposed to weather conditions prevalent at the time.
Building temperature may vary during each season and the work environment may be unseasonably cold or warm during the year.

The Summit ESC operates three programs in surrounding districts:
Integrated Preschool Program
Preschool aged children with special needs as well as typically developing peers
Locations throughout Summit County including Cuyahoga Falls, Copley-Fairlawn, Coventry, Field, Manchester, Mogadore, Nordonia Hills, Revere, Stow-Munroe Falls, Tallmadge, and Woodridge
KIDS FIRST
Serving students with an Autism Spectrum Diagnosis, preschool-6th grade, from throughout Summit County
Located in the Copley-Fairlawn School District
TOPS (Transition Opportunity Program for Students)
High school students from throughout Summit County
Located in Tallmadge School District
Duties of a Classroom Aide Include:
Assisting in the preparation of teacher-made instructional materials
Setting up and cleaning up specific centers in classroom (art, music, fine motor, etc.)
Assisting the teacher in supervising children (for example halls, restrooms, playground, during gross motor activities, snack/lunch, and boarding the bus)
Helping the children with daily living skills (including, but not limited to: removing coat, zipping, buttoning, tying shoes, and toileting)
Assisting with behavior interventions and reinforcement activities as directed by the teacher
